The Inter-American Development Bank (IDB) selected the Terramiga Program as one of the seven initiatives that will represent it to compete in the Development Impact Honors Competition.The award, granted by the U.S. Treasury Department, recognizes high impact projects for social development.

Thirty actions signed up with IDB.Terramiga stood out for the significant results that it has already achieved, in addition to the wealth of audiovisual records.From 2006 to 2010, the program benefited the cooperatives associated with the Bahia Southern Lowlands Environmental Protection Area Mosaic Integrated and Sustainable Development Program (PDIS), supported by the Odebrecht Foundation.

The Igrapiúna Rural Family Home (CFR-I) – a teaching unit that is also part of PDIS – also celebrated its nomination as finalist for the Banco do Brasil Foundation Social Technology Award.CFR-I, which entered the project “Training of Young Rural Entrepreneurs,” is part of a group of 27 selected from the 264 projects that meet the criteria set out in the public notice. In all, there were 1,116 projects entered.The awarded project will be announced on November 22 in Brasília (DF).
